Senses
trældom is used for these senses in English:
- servitude The state of being a slave; slavery; being forced to work for others or do their bidding without one's consent or against one's will, either in perpetuity or for a period of time over which one has little or no control.
- thraldom (literary, or, puristic, otherwise, archaic) A state of bondage, slavery, or subjugation to another person.
- thrall (uncountable) The state of being under the control of another person.
